Order books for the Ferrari Purosangue have temporarily closed, a report has claimed, due to a two-year-long waiting list
Autocar contacted Ferrari for clarification, but the manufacturer declined to comment.
Autocar previously reported that the manufacturer was limiting the Purosangue to 20% of its annual orders. It's on track to sell a total of 12,000 cars this year – having shipped 9894 units in the nine months to 30 September 2022 – so is expected to produce around 2500 units of the SUV annually.once the brand announced it was powered by a V12 engine, incurring “a long list of requests coming from non-existing customers as well as current customers”.
Galliera added that the brand “was not expecting early cars to be delivered to non-existing customers”, prioritising current customers for early cars. The first UK deliveries are expected to begin next summer, a few months after those for left-hand-drive cars. The four-seat Purosangue is positioned to complete Ferrari’s line-up. “You can now have a Ferrari with a family,” said Galliera.
